Soft Touch

I gotta be real careful, you know. Some of these bottles are older than I am, I don’t wanna break them with my great big claws. That won’t do. And some folks ask for the same bottle back each time, then they know they’re looked after and listened to. They’re like old friends, coming back after a few days away.

I’ve only ever broken one and it spooked the life out of me. I was only little, then. It took me a while to learn to be soft, it’s in my nature to be strong, but soft has its benefits. I get more hugs and treats, and when I need to be strong, my strength looks all the more impressive. And then I get even more treats. It’s win-win.
